ShowPower – Geneva Motor Show 2014

ShowPower battery packs powering the Ford Vehicles at the Geneva Motor Show 2015.
Client:
Ford
Event:
Geneva MotoShow 2014
Location:
Switzerland
ShowPower battery packs powering the Ford Vehicles at the Geneva Motor Show 2015.
Client:
Ford
Event:
Geneva MotoShow 2014
Location:
Switzerland